General Contractor Services for Penthouse Roof Overlay Project Base Bid: Installation of two complete roof overlay systems at penthouse roof areas. Includes removal, temporary storage, cleaning, reinstallation, testing, inspection, and certification of the existing lightning protection system. Bid Alternate No. 1: Extension or replacement of existing roof access ladder. Bid Alternate No. 2: Complete replacement of the existing lightning protection system.

This is a Request for Bids (RFB) for electrical upgrades at tower sites for the Kentucky State Police (KSP). The project includes modifications to existing electrical systems, such as installing new transformers, panelboards, transfer switches, and surge protection panels. Entire Official Bid Document and Bid Bond ( if required) should be combined as one PDF and uploaded This project includes modifications to existing electrical systems serving Kentucky State Police facilities located at four existing KET sites. Electrical renovations at each site generally include: 1. New 50 kVA transformer. 2. New 200 amp panelboard. 3. New 200 amp manual transfer switch. 4. New surge protection panel. 5. Miscellaneous circuit breakers, conduit and conductors.

Email and documentation encryption services Implementation and configuration of Microsoft Purview capabilities for data classification, encryption, data loss prevention, lifecycle management, and records management across the Durham Police Department' s Microsoft 365 GCC environment and workstations. This includes automating encryption for email and file sharing, applying labels with recipient authentication, enforcing encryption based on metadata, encrypting emails sent to group addresses, setting access expiration, preventing unauthorized file transfer, enforcing encryption retroactively and ongoing, ensuring Microsoft products can be screened and labeled, persisting encryption for forwarded files, applying labeling retroactively to archives, regulating sensitive file storage and transfer, restricting recipient actions ( print, download, copy, forward), enabling permanent protection with revocation capability, creating DLP endpoint for scanned documents, protecting image- based evidence using content inspec

Willisburg Lake Dam Rehabilitation Project Rehabilitation of Willisburg Lake Dam, including construction of a reinforced concrete auxiliary spillway with precast concrete culverts, a reinforced concrete stepped chute, a reinforced concrete stilling basin, a reinforced concrete floodwall with concrete cutoff, and a rockfill stability berm. Work also includes a new low- level drawdown valve, remediation of concrete cracking and seepage in the principal spillway culvert, abandonment of the existing raw water intake and installation of new intake lines, demolition of existing storm sewer infrastructure, raw water lines, concrete ditches, and portions of the principal spillway culvert and wingwalls. Site preparation, erosion control, slope construction and protection, construction access, selective demolition, earthwork, temporary shoring, traffic control, storm drainage, site grading, and restoration work are also included.

Entire Official Bid Document and Bid Bond ( if required) should be combined as one PDF and uploaded The Base BID Work shall include construction of a reinforced concrete auxiliary spillway with two, 8 feet by 16 feet, precast concrete culverts through the dam crest to serve as the spillway inlet with a reinforced concrete stepped chute along the downstream slope that discharges into a reinforced concrete stilling basin at the toe of the dam. A reinforced concrete floodwall with concrete cutoff shall be constructed along the upstream crest of the dam along KY- 555 with rockfill placed along the upstream slope of the dam. A rockfill stability berm shall be constructed along the downstream slope. The BASE BID Work further includes a new low- level drawdown valve in the dry well of the riser structure, replacement of the existing low level drawdown valve, and remediation of concrete cracking and seepage in the existing principal spillway culvert. In addition, the City of Springfields raw water intake will be abandoned and new raw water intake lines installed within the principal spillway culvert. A Contractor designed Water Diversion Plan is required. The BASE BID Work will also consist of site preparation, erosion and sedimentation control, slope construction and protection, construction access, selective demolition, earthwork, temporary shoring, traffic control and maintenance, storm drainage, and site grading and restoration work.
